<?php /** * The check model class. * * @package WCPay\Fraud_Prevention\Models */ namespace WCPay\Fraud_Prevention\Models; use WCPay\Exceptions\Fraud_Ruleset_Exception; /** * Check model. */ class Check { // Check operators. const OPERATOR_EQUALS = 'equals'; const OPERATOR_NOT_EQUALS = 'not_equals'; const OPERATOR_GTE = 'greater_or_equal'; const OPERATOR_GT = 'greater_than'; const OPERATOR_LTE = 'less_or_equal'; const OPERATOR_LT = 'less_than'; const OPERATOR_IN = 'in'; const OPERATOR_NOT_IN = 'not_in'; // Checklist operators. const LIST_OPERATOR_AND = 'and'; const LIST_OPERATOR_OR = 'or'; /** * List of check operators. * * @var array */ private static $check_operators = [ self::OPERATOR_EQUALS, self::OPERATOR_NOT_EQUALS, self::OPERATOR_GT, self::OPERATOR_GTE, self::OPERATOR_LT, self::OPERATOR_LTE, self::OPERATOR_IN, self::OPERATOR_NOT_IN, ]; /** * List of checklist operators. * * @var array */ private static $list_operators = [ self::LIST_OPERATOR_AND, self::LIST_OPERATOR_OR, ]; /** * Operator for the Check. * * @var string */ public $operator = null; /** * The key of the source which contains the data. Is mapped to a real data to compare with the value on the Fraud_Ruleset_Service. * * @var string */ public $key = null; /** * Value to check against the source. * * @var mixed */ public $value = null; /** * Subchecks array that when filled, indicates this is a checklist. * * @var array */ public $checks = []; /** * Creates a Check instance from an array. * * @param array $array The Check configuration. * * @return Check * @throws Fraud_Ruleset_Exception When the array validation fails. */ public static function from_array( array $array ): Check { // Check if this is a valid candidate for a rule. Rules should have keys, outcomes, and checks defined and not empty. if ( ! self::validate_array( $array ) ) { throw new Fraud_Ruleset_Exception( 'Check definition not valid.' ); } $check = new self(); $check->key = $array['key'] ?? null; $check->operator = $array['operator']; $check->value = $array['value'] ?? null; if ( isset( $array['checks'] ) ) { foreach ( $array['checks'] as $check_definition ) { $check->checks[] = self::from_array( $check_definition ); } } return $check; } /** * Validates the given array if it's structured to become a Check object. * * @param array $array The array to validate. * * @return bool Whether it is a valid Check array. */ public static function validate_array( array $array ): bool { // Check if this array contains an operator. In all cases it should have an operator field. if ( ! isset( $array['operator'] ) ) { return false; } if ( in_array( $array['operator'], self::$list_operators, true ) ) { // This should be a checklist, and should have checks. if ( ! isset( $array['checks'] ) || empty( $array['checks'] ) ) { return false; } // Validate child checks. foreach ( $array['checks'] as $check ) { if ( ! self::validate_array( $check ) ) { return false; } } } elseif ( in_array( $array['operator'], self::$check_operators, true ) ) { // This should be a single check, and should have key and value. if ( ! isset( $array['value'] ) ) { return false; } if ( ! isset( $array['key'] ) ) { return false; } } else { return false; } return true; } /** * Creates a list type of check with the given parameters. * * @param string $operator The checklist operator. * @param array $checks The child checks array. * * @return Check * @throws Fraud_Ruleset_Exception When the validation fails. */ public static function list( string $operator, array $checks ) { if ( ! in_array( $operator, self::$list_operators, true ) ) { // $operator is a predefined constant, no need to escape. // phpcs:ignore WordPress.Security.EscapeOutput throw new Fraud_Ruleset_Exception( 'Operator for the check is invalid: ' . $operator ); } if ( 0 < count( array_filter( $checks, function ( $check ) { return ! ( $check instanceof Check ); } ) ) ) { throw new Fraud_Ruleset_Exception( 'The checklist checks should only contain Check objects.' ); } $checklist = new Check(); $checklist->operator = $operator; $checklist->checks = $checks; return $checklist; } /** * Creates a list type of check with the given parameters. * * @param string $key The key of the check. * @param string $operator The check operator. * @param mixed $value The value to compare against. * * @return Check * @throws Fraud_Ruleset_Exception When the validation fails. */ public static function check( string $key, string $operator, $value ) { if ( ! in_array( $operator, self::$check_operators, true ) ) { // $operator is a predefined constant, no need to escape. // phpcs:ignore WordPress.Security.EscapeOutput throw new Fraud_Ruleset_Exception( 'Operator for the check is invalid: ' . $operator ); } $check = new Check(); $check->operator = $operator; $check->key = $key; $check->value = $value; return $check; } /** * Converts the class to it's array representation for transmission. * * @return array */ public function to_array() { if ( ! empty( $this->checks ) ) { return [ 'operator' => $this->operator, 'checks' => array_map( function ( Check $check ) { return $check->to_array(); }, $this->checks ), ]; } return [ 'key' => $this->key, 'operator' => $this->operator, 'value' => $this->value, ]; } }
